(Fighting against New Coronary Pneumonia) Jiangsu's 13 districts and cities announced the entry and exit policies of 9 cities with low risk throughout the region

  China News Service, Nanjing, March 20 (Reporter Zhu Xiaoying) On the 20th, the Jiangsu Provincial Department of Transportation sorted out and announced the entry and exit policies of 13 districts and cities in the province.

  At present, Nanjing, Changzhou, Lianyungang and Suqian in Jiangsu are designated as medium and high risk areas.

Among them, Nanjing currently has 1 high-risk area and 9 medium-risk areas, Changzhou currently has 1 high-risk area and 8 medium-risk areas, Lianyungang currently has 99 medium-risk areas, and Suqian currently has 1 medium-risk area.

Wuxi, Xuzhou, Suzhou, Nantong, Huai'an, Yancheng, Yangzhou, Zhenjiang, and Taizhou are all low-risk areas.

  The entry and exit policies of districted cities in medium and high-risk areas are relatively strict.

  The policies for entering and leaving Changzhou, Lianyungang and Suqian are also stricter.

  For those who intend to enter Wuxi, Xuzhou, Suzhou, Huai'an, Yancheng, Yangzhou, Zhenjiang, and Taizhou, they must hold a negative nucleic acid test certificate within 48 hours, and the requirements vary from place to place.

Some cities require that they report to the local area within a certain period of time after arriving in the city, and do a nucleic acid test again.

Local governments have also put forward relevant requirements for people who plan to leave the above-mentioned areas.
